Output d3128685fc26df6330dcee087c25facfffd8669e08b447968fbde1b813d84118:5

value
1912026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9cea75f4a8de57df63d610eabcb8d5c5e044019 OP_EQUALVERIFY OP_CHECKSIG
address
1KQ4P7hZh93Ma6ckJ71zjwxnAg9taJGeVA
transaction
d3128685fc26df6330dcee087c25facfffd8669e08b447968fbde1b813d84118
spent
true